What Is a Dental Bone Graft?
A dental bone graft is a specialized surgical procedure aimed at augmenting or replacing lost or deficient jawbone tissue. By placing a compatible bone graft material into the area of deficiency, it creates a robust structural base that supports future dental implant placement.
Bone grafting is indicated when available bone volume is insufficient to anchor a dental implant securely. Bone loss can result from prolonged tooth loss, natural jawbone resorption, advanced periodontal disease, or traumatic jaw injuries.
Beyond simply increasing bone volume, a bone graft acts as a scaffold that stimulates the body to regenerate natural bone tissue gradually. Over time, the graft material integrates with existing bone, preparing the jaw to receive a stable, long-lasting dental implant.
The choice of grafting material and surgical technique varies from patient to patient. Every treatment plan begins with a comprehensive diagnostic examination and 3D imaging to assess bone density, site volume, and anatomical needs.

Indications for Dental Bone Grafting
A patient requires a dental bone graft when remaining jawbone height, width, or density is insufficient to support an implant safely. This loss of support often stems from prolonged tooth loss, advanced periodontitis, or localized structural resorption.
Primary Reasons for Bone Grafting:
- Prolonged Tooth Loss: Long-term absence of tooth roots deprives the jawbone of functional stimulation, causing gradual resorption.
- Advanced Periodontitis: Chronic gum disease damages supporting alveolar bone structures.
- Delayed Tooth Replacement: Postponing tooth replacement after an extraction allows bone loss to progress.
- Past Dental Infections or Abscesses: Localized bacterial infections can destroy surrounding bone tissue.
- Traumatic Jaw Injuries: External impact or trauma can fracture or compromise alveolar bone.
- Inherent Bone Density Deficits: Naturally thin or porous bone architecture.
- Maxillary Sinus Proximity: Insufficient vertical bone height in the posterior upper jaw due to sinus pneumatization (requiring a sinus lift).
- Long-Term Removable Denture Use: Dentures place uneven pressure on ridges, accelerating underlying bone loss over time.
Additional Factors Influencing Bone Loss:
- Long-Term Medications: Extended use of specific pharmaceuticals, such as systemic corticosteroids or chemotherapeutic agents.
- Chronic Health Conditions: Uncontrolled diabetes or systemic conditions affecting bone turnover.
- Advanced Age: Natural reductions in bone density, particularly in patients over 65.
- Lifestyle Factors: Tobacco use, smoking, and poor daily oral hygiene.
A comprehensive clinical assessment and 3D imaging (CBCT) determine whether a bone graft is necessary for your specific case.
Signs of Jawbone Loss
Jawbone loss often develops silently without significant pain or obvious symptoms. Many patients only discover bone deficits during a routine examination or when planning for dental implants.
However, subtle clinical signs may indicate bone resorption:
- Loose or shifting adjacent teeth.
- Delayed gingival healing following a tooth extraction.
- Changes in gum contours or receded gum margins.
- Visible exposure of underlying bone margins within the mouth.
- Numbness, tingling, or a feeling of heaviness in the jaw.
- Localized gum tenderness, swelling, or redness related to underlying inflammation.
- Persistent sores or discharge in the affected jaw area.
Because these signs do not reveal the exact extent of bone loss on their own, professional 3D imaging is required to evaluate the underlying jaw structure.

The Bone Grafting Procedure: Step-by-Step
Bone grafting follows a precise clinical sequence to ensure optimal healing and bone integration:
- Diagnostic Evaluation: Assessment of bone loss volume and site geometry using 3D CBCT scans.
- Anesthesia Administration: Application of local anesthesia (or sedation) to ensure complete comfort during surgery.
- Site Preparation: Creating a small incision in the gum tissue to expose the targeted bone deficit.
- Graft Placement: Precise application of selected bone graft material into the deficient area.
- Graft Stabilization: Securing the graft material with specialized protective membranes or structural pins if necessary.
- Suturing & Closure: Closing the soft tissue site carefully to protect the graft during early healing.
- Osseous Integration: Over several months, the body naturally incorporates the graft material, forming dense new bone.
- Follow-Up & Assessment: Evaluating graft healing via X-rays before proceeding to implant placement.
Can Jawbone Regenerate Naturally?
On its own, significant jawbone loss does not naturally regenerate back to its original volume. Once alveolar bone resorbs—especially following long-term tooth loss or periodontal damage—the body does not rebuild the missing height or width without intervention.
When bone volume is insufficient for implants, surgical bone grafting is required to provide the scaffold necessary for new bone growth.
Can Bone Grafting and Immediate Implants Be Combined?
Yes. In specific clinical cases, a bone graft can be placed simultaneously with an immediate dental implant. This is feasible when remaining natural bone provides sufficient primary stability to hold the implant securely, and the bone deficit is minor or localized.
However, simultaneous placement is not suitable for every presentation. When severe bone loss, active localized infection, or inadequate primary stability is present, a staged approach—placing the graft first and allowing complete healing before implant placement—is necessary for predictable results.
What to Expect After Surgery & Post-Care Guidelines
After a bone graft procedure, a healing period is required for the graft to incorporate properly. Mild, temporary post-operative symptoms are normal parts of the recovery process:
- Localized discomfort or mild soreness at the surgical site.
- Minor swelling or slight bruising around the cheeks or gums.
- Mild oozing during the first 24 to 48 hours.
- Tiny, sand-like graft particles occasionally loosening from the site during early healing.
Essential Post-Operative Care Tips:
- Soft Diet: Eat soft, lukewarm foods during the first few days; avoid chewing on the surgical site.
- Gentle Oral Hygiene: Clean your mouth carefully according to your dentist's specific instructions; avoid rigorous rinsing.
- Protect the Site: Do not disturb, touch, or apply pressure to the surgical area.
- Medication Compliance: Take prescribed antibiotics and anti-inflammatory medications as directed.
- Avoid Smoking: Refrain from traditional and electronic cigarettes, as nicotine severely hinders blood flow and graft integration.
- Limit Physical Exertion: Avoid strenuous exercise or heavy lifting for the period recommended by your surgeon.
- Attend Follow-Ups: Keep all scheduled follow-up visits to monitor healing progress.
